"""Persist detection results for a project. The detection cache is a JSON file (``detections.json`` at the project root) that maps each image to its detections so reopening a project doesn't have to re-run the detector. The cache file lives apart from the images (which sit in the project's ``frames/`` sub-folder), so the file location and the image base directory are passed separately. The cache is tagged with the detector identity (name + model + conf/imgsz); a mismatch means the cache was produced by a different detector and is ignored (``load_results`` returns ``None``) rather than shown as if current. Keys are stored as **basenames**, so the cache survives moving/renaming the project folder. """ from __future__ import annotations import json import os from pathlib import Path from .types import Detection _VERSION = 1 def _atomic_write_text(path: Path, text: str) -> None: """Write ``text`` to ``path`` crash-safely: write a sibling .tmp, then os.replace. ``os.replace`` is atomic on the same filesystem (incl. NTFS), so a crash mid-write leaves the previous file intact instead of a truncated/corrupt one — important for a large detections.json that holds tens of thousands of entries. """ tmp = path.with_name(path.name + ".tmp") try: tmp.write_text(text, encoding="utf-8") os.replace(tmp, path) finally: if tmp.exists(): try: tmp.unlink() except OSError: pass def make_key( models: list[str], yolo_conf: float, yolo_imgsz: int, nms_iou: float | None = None ) -> dict: """Identity of the detector set that produced a cache; cache is only valid for a match. Keyed by the (sorted) model **basenames** so it's portable across machines/paths. ``nms_iou`` is only added to the key when cross-model NMS is enabled — so the default (NMS off) key is unchanged and existing caches stay valid; turning NMS on yields a distinct key (its merged results differ) without invalidating the non-NMS cache. """ key = { "models": sorted(Path(m).name for m in models), "yolo_conf": round(float(yolo_conf), 4), "yolo_imgsz": int(yolo_imgsz), } if nms_iou is not None: key["nms_iou"] = round(float(nms_iou), 4) return key def save_results(cache_file: Path, key: dict, results: dict[str, list[Detection]]) -> bool: """Write the cache (basename -> detections) to ``cache_file``. False on failure.""" payload = { "version": _VERSION, "key": key, "results": { Path(p).name: [d.to_dict() for d in dets] for p, dets in results.items() }, } try: cache_file.parent.mkdir(parents=True, exist_ok=True) _atomic_write_text(cache_file, json.dumps(payload, ensure_ascii=False)) return True except OSError: return False def load_results(cache_file: Path, key: dict, base_dir: Path) -> dict[str, list[Detection]] | None: """Load cached detections from ``cache_file`` if present and the detector matches. Returns a dict keyed by **full path** (``base_dir / basename``), or ``None`` if there is no cache, it's unreadable, or it was made by a different detector. """ if not cache_file.is_file(): return None try: payload = json.loads(cache_file.read_text(encoding="utf-8")) except (OSError, ValueError): return None if payload.get("version") != _VERSION or payload.get("key") != key: return None out: dict[str, list[Detection]] = {} for name, dets in payload.get("results", {}).items(): try: out[str(base_dir / name)] = [Detection.from_dict(d) for d in dets] except (KeyError, TypeError, ValueError): continue # skip a corrupt entry, keep the rest return out
